Message type: E = Error
Message class: HRGB_LGPS - HR: Messages for LGPS
Message number: 103
Message text: File Format &1 does not exist. (i.e. it is not a structure in SE11)

(i.e. it is not a structure in SE11) ?The SAP error message HRGB_LGPS103 indicates that the system is unable to find a specified file format, which is likely related to a configuration or setup issue in the SAP system. This error typically occurs in the context of HR (Human Resources) processes, particularly when dealing with file uploads or data imports.
Cause:
- Missing Structure: The error suggests that the file format specified does not correspond to any existing structure in the SAP Data Dictionary (SE11). This could be due to a typo in the file format name or the structure not being created or activated in the system.
- Configuration Issues: The configuration settings for the HR module may not be correctly set up, leading to the system not recognizing the specified file format.
- Transport Issues: If the structure was recently transported from another system, it may not have been transported correctly or may not exist in the target system.
-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the structure, leading to the perception that it does not exist.
Solution:
Check Structure in SE11:
- Go to transaction SE11 and check if the specified file format (structure) exists. If it does not, you may need to create it or correct the name in your configuration.
Verify Configuration:
- Review the configuration settings related to the HR module, especially those pertaining to file formats and data imports. Ensure that all necessary settings are correctly defined.
Transport Check:
- If the structure was supposed to be transported from another system, check the transport logs to ensure that it was successfully imported. If not, you may need to re-transport it.
Authorization Check:
-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the structure. You may need to consult with your security team to verify this.
Consult Documentation:
- Review any relevant SAP documentation or notes related to the specific HR process you are working with. There may be specific instructions or known issues documented by SAP.
Contact SAP Support:
- If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. They may have additional insights or patches available for your specific version of SAP.
